What Is Assisted Stretching?
Assisted stretching is a hands-on technique guided by a physical therapist. The therapist positions the body and applies controlled assistance to help joints and muscles move through safe ranges of motion. Unlike independent stretching, a therapist monitors alignment, breathing, and muscle response during each movement, helping to ensure good outcomes.
Assisted stretching focuses on mobility and movement quality, aiming to restore joint motion, reduce protective muscle tension, and improve how the body moves during daily tasks. We often incorporate it into rehabilitation programs as a complement to active exercise.
What To Expect During Assisted Stretching
Each assisted stretching session begins with a brief movement check. The physical therapist identifies areas of restriction and movement patterns that affect function. The therapist then guides the body through targeted stretches using precise positioning and steady pressure.
Patients remain relaxed and engaged during treatment. The therapist cues breathing and posture to support comfortable motion while adjusting pressure and range based on response. This process helps the nervous system accept movement without excessive guarding.
During the session, our therapist will also explain how mobility changes influence posture, walking, or exercise. This guidance helps patients apply better movement habits outside the clinic.
When You Should Consider Active Stretching
Limited mobility can alter movement patterns and increase strain on other areas. Over time, these compensations may affect posture, balance, and activity tolerance. Assisted stretching helps address restrictions that interfere with efficient movement.
This treatment benefits a wide range of individuals:
- Office workers benefit when prolonged sitting affects hip or spine mobility.
- Athletes benefit when training demands create muscle tension or asymmetry
- People recovering from injury or surgery benefit when stiffness limits progress with exercise.
